a/c pump works but does not stop-start
a/c pump works but does not stop-start
My A/C pump always intermittently started and stopped whilst it mainted temperature. The disc on the back of the pump clicked on and off about once every 30 seconds. Now, it's permanently-on, unless switched off. Now and then it will work correctly (so is an intermittent fault) but does anyone know how to correct this -is it controlled by some kind of relay/servo that's serviceable?

do you mean the a/c compressor? if so it is controlled the low and high pressure switch and should cycle on and off. if it stuck on then do not use it or the system will freeze up. check the low pressure switch it is probly going bad not cutting the compressor off

If it's full of freon, the pump can run constantly without causing a problem. Mine will only cycle when the fan is turned down and I'm driving down the highway. Any other time and it runs constant. It will sit and idle with the A/C compressor running constant. I haven't touched the A/C system since I've had it--9 years. If you do get a constant on-off-on-off then you may be low on freon.
